Gambling has been a form of entertainment for centuries, with evidence of games of chance being played in ancient civilizations like China, Egypt, and Rome. However, it has also been a controversial topic, with many debates surrounding its effects on society. Some see it as a harmless activity, while others view it as a dangerous addiction. However, no matter what your view may be, there’s no denying that gambling plays a significant role in our society, with its high risk and allure of instant gratification.

The allure of gambling lies in its ability to offer the possibility of winning large sums of money with just a small initial investment. This chance to strike it big can be tempting to anyone, regardless of their financial status. For some, the idea of winning big is enough to keep them coming back to the casinos, betting on sports, or playing the lottery. This is especially true for those who are struggling financially, as the idea of an easy way out of their struggles can be hard to resist.

On the other hand, gambling also has its fair share of risks, both to the individual and society as a whole. The thrill of taking a chance and potentially winning something significant also comes with the risk of losing everything. This risk is what separates gambling from other forms of entertainment, as the potential for both great gains and great losses is always present. This can lead to addiction and financial problems, especially for those who are predisposed to impulsive behavior or have a history of problem gambling in their family.

Apart from its effects on individuals, gambling also has a significant impact on society. Many argue that it can bring in revenue and boost the economy, as seen in popular gambling destinations like Las Vegas and Macau. However, this revenue often comes at a price, with studies showing that areas with a high concentration of casinos also experience higher rates of crime, bankruptcy, and addiction. Additionally, the money spent on gambling could have been allocated to other important sectors of society, such as education or healthcare.

Moreover, the glamorization of gambling in the media and popular culture can also lead to a normalization of the activity, especially amongst younger generations. The rise of online gambling and mobile betting has made it easier for individuals, including minors, to access and participate in gambling activities. This increases the potential for addiction and financial ruin, as well as the need for stronger regulations to protect vulnerable individuals.
